Depends what you want to do...
We have a robodrill with a 31i and the control is better that our other machines with OiMC. This is from an operators point of view: better text editing, file handling, proper copy/paste etc.
We don't use manual guide and program everyting off line.
We also have a siemens 810T lathe with sinumeric.
This control rocks for program creation and verification, and in my opinion, why would you want to program a lathe off line, as it is so fast and easy on the control?
Before buying the siemens we had a proper look at manual guide (on a lathe) and it was crap in comparison. Thats why we went siemens.
Also, if you get a hard drive it will need replacing after around 3 years.
Maybe better to go for a control with as much memory as possible but withour the hard drive.
